Modi Govt committed to Tourism boost: Ashok Koul Assures swift redressal of hoteliers’ issues in Pahalgam

Pahalgam, Nov 28 (KINS): Jammu & Kashmir BJP General Secretary (Organization) Ashok Koul on Friday met hoteliers and local stakeholders in Pahalgam, where he listened to their concerns and assured timely intervention through the appropriate government and party channels.
The interaction was aimed at strengthening coordination between the tourism industry and policymakers, ensuring sustained growth of the region’s hospitality sector.
During the meeting, hoteliers apprised Koul of several operational challenges, including infrastructure gaps, regulatory hurdles, and the need for better tourist facilities. After giving a patient hearing to their grievances, Koul reiterated the BJP’s commitment to supporting the tourism sector, which he described as a crucial pillar of Jammu & Kashmir’s economic development.
He highlighted that the people-oriented and welfare-driven governance model of Prime Minister Narendra Modi has brought significant benefits to Jammu & Kashmir over the past 11 years, particularly after August 5, 2019. He said the region has witnessed unprecedented socio-economic development, with major reforms ensuring transparency, accountability, and inclusive growth.
Referring to the recent terror attack in Pahalgam, Koul said that despite such unfortunate incidents, the popular tourist destination—like several others in the Valley—continues to witness remarkable growth in tourist inflow. He added that the increasing interest of Indian and international film industries in Kashmir is evidence of the improved security environment and enhanced infrastructure developed under the Modi government. This renewed cinematic attention, he said, will further generate employment and business opportunities for local youth.
Koul stressed that under the dynamic leadership of Prime Minister Narendra Modi, the BJP remains committed to holistic development and securing a brighter future for the youth of Jammu & Kashmir. He assured hoteliers that their issues would be prioritized and resolved, reaffirming the government’s commitment to creating a more conducive environment for tourism, entrepreneurship, and sustainable growth.
The meeting ended on a positive note, with stakeholders appreciating the BJP leadership for directly engaging with grassroots representatives and addressing key sectoral challenges with seriousness and commitment. Hoteliers also discussed the need for strong confidence-building measures in the aftermath of the recent massacre to further strengthen the region’s tourism sector.(KINS)
